How Much Does Field Trip Transportation in Tyler Cost?
The table below compares estimated Field Trip Transportation transportation rates in Tyler by vehicle type so you can review typical hourly, daily, and mileage costs.
| Type of Bus | Per Hour | Per Day | Per Mile |
|---|---|---|---|
| Coach Bus | $180 – $485 | $1,400 – $3,800 | $4.50 – $8.75 |
| Minibus | $135 – $475 | $1,350 – $3,650 | $5.00 – $8.50 |
| School Bus | $150 – $465 | $1,350 – $3,550 | $5.00 – $7.50 |
| Shuttle Bus | $135 – $475 | $1,350 – $3,650 | $5.00 – $7.50 |
| Sprinter Van | $135 – $445 | $1,350 – $3,350 | $5.00 – $7.50 |
| Party Bus | $135 – $545 | $1,350 – $3,750 | $5.00 – $7.50 |
| Final Field Trip Transportation pricing depends on trip timing, stop count, route distance, passenger total, and vehicle availability. | |||
